Consumer protection act, 2019 is a law to protect the interests of the consumers. this act provides safety to consumers regarding defective products, dissatisfactory services, and unfair trade practices. the basic aim of the consumer protection act, 2019 is to save the rights of the consumers by establishing authorities for timely and effective. The salient features of consumer protection act (cpa) 2019 are as follows: (a) it is applicable to all goods, services and unfair trade practices unless specifically exempted by the central government. (b) it covers all sectors private, public as well as co operative. (c) it provides three tier machinery for settling consumer grievances. The consumer protection act, 2019 contains provisions for product liability, unfair contracts and it also includes three new unfair trade practices. in contrast, the old act just stated six types of unfair trade practices. the act of 2019 acts as the advisory body for the promotion and protection of consumer rights.

Regulator. one of the most significant differences between the two acts is the establishment of a dedicated regulatory authority in the consumer protection act 2019. in the 1986 act, there was no specific regulator to oversee and address common unfair practices by sellers.
